Hks bov doesn't sound right on Evo X
 
Hi, first, thanks for looking at this post.
I recently installed Hks bov on my Evo X, but the sound just doesn't sound right. Can anyone help? Is it normal or harmful? And how to fix it? I did lots of research, bit there is not a reliable way to fix it. I just want to make the sound to sound normal and sharp.

Scott@HKSUSA Jan 13, 2014 12:20 PM

Free-reving won't sound the same as when you're under load. Letting off at 6000+ rpm and ~20 psi will sound a lot different.

I don't hear anything "wrong" in your video - but if you don't think the response is as fast as it should be, make the vac/boost reference line as short as possible. And if you're using those in-line air filters on the reference line, make sure they are new and/or clean.
